Camp In

Last night my son and I and a few hundred fourth and fifth graders spent the night at the Denver museum of Nature and Science. It was a very interesting experience. We arrived at 5:30pm and then had three hour long classes which were themed around the grossology exhibit. We had lung power, marvelous mucus, and it is good to be gross. In the first class we learned about the respiratory system and the teacher dissected sheep lungs for the class. In the second class we learned how wonderful mucus is and that we swallow on the average of a quart of snot a day. We also got to make our own boogers. I have the recipe if anyone is interested. In the last class we got to pretend we were dung beetles and make our own dung balls. We also learned that rabbits eat their own poop in order to get the most nutrients out of it. YUCK!!!!
